Custom elements & non-standard events

Status: Proposed follow-on to the wire events model
(ARCHITECTURE.md) — optional, undated
Date: June 2026

irid maps on* handler args to DOM events by stripping on and
lowercasing (onCursorChangedcursorchanged), and hardcodes two-way
autobind for the value/checked IDL properties on standard form
elements. Both rules cover standard events on standard HTML elements.
Two gaps remain, both about reaching beyond that vocabulary:

  • Non-standard events on standard elements — jQuery-plugin events,
    Stimulus, bubbled CustomEvents, vendor-prefixed events. The
    strip-on/lowercase rule can't spell these.
  • Custom elements (Web Components) — hyphen-named elements with their
    own event names, property-only rich values, and no universal autobind
    convention.

Both build on the wire events model (ARCHITECTURE.md
— per-slot wire config, two-way-capable bound props); this doc adds
vocabulary, not new config machinery.


1. on: — verbatim event names

An on: prefix means "use the rest of this string verbatim as the event
name," bypassing the strip-on/lowercase rule:

tags$div(
  `on:webkit-fullscreen-change` = handler,
  `on:library:custom.event`     = wire(handler2, wire_debounce(50))
)

Backticks are required for the colon (and any hyphen), which doubles as a
visual signal that the name is the literal wire form. The slot is an
ordinary on* slot, so it takes a bare handler or an wire exactly
like any other event.

This is strictly cleaner than the original sketch, which needed a parallel
.timing = list(\on:…` = …)keyed list to configure these — re-spelling the verbatim name in a second place. Under thewire` model, config rides
the slot, so the verbatim name appears exactly once.

on: is handler-only — it names an event to listen to. Two-way binding on
a standard element is the hardcoded value/checked autobind; declared
autobind on a custom element is custom_tag()'s job (§2).


2. custom_tag() — declaring a Web Component's vocabulary

Custom elements come from outside the platform's standard vocabulary:
their event names aren't derivable by camelCase transformation, they often
need rich values set as JS properties rather than HTML attributes, and
they have no universal autobind convention. Rather than guess,
custom_tag() asks the author to declare the element's vocabulary once:

SlInput <- custom_tag(
  "sl-input",
  events     = c(onInput = "sl-input", onChange = "sl-change"),  # on*-arg → wire event name
  properties = c("value"),                                       # set as JS property, not attribute
  bind       = c(value = "onInput")                              # two-way: value, signaled by onInput
)

# Callers get plain-tag ergonomics with the element's vocabulary baked in:
SlInput(value = my_reactive, onChange = handle)

custom_tag() returns a function that behaves like a tags$*
constructor with the element's name, events, properties, and autobind
baked in. Three concerns:

Event-name mapping (events =)

Maps each R on* arg to the element's real (non-standard) wire event
name. onInput = "sl-input" means an onInput arg registers a listener
for the sl-input CustomEvent. Handlers still take a bare function or
an wire per the wire model — including dom_opts, since a custom
element emits real (often cancelable) CustomEvents, so prevent_default
/ stop_propagation / capture apply.

Attribute vs. property (properties =)

Many Web Components can't accept rich values (arrays, objects) as HTML
attributes — they need JS properties set directly. properties =
declares which names are set as properties rather than attributes. (irid
already special-cases value/disabled/checked/innerHTML as
properties on the client; this extends that set per custom element.)

Open: the original sketch also proposed a per-instance .prop /
.value dot-prefix for ad-hoc property marking. That conflicts with
the wire model's removal of all dot-prefix element props. So per-instance
property marking wants a non-dot mechanism — likely a small wrapper
(irid_prop(value)) rather than a .-arg. Left open; the
element-type-level properties = declaration covers the common case.

Declared autobind (bind =)

bind = c(value = "onInput") declares the (prop, event) autobind
triple
that the platform hardcodes for <input>'s value
input/change. Under the wire model, value becomes a two-way-capable
bound prop: the framework shows the reactive inbound and, on the declared
event (onInputsl-input), reads the element's value property and
writes it back — with the same read-only snap-back and timing semantics as
DOM autobind.

So custom_tag is exactly "DOM autobind, but you declare the triple the
platform doesn't know."
There is no synthesized write_back handler
(the original framing) — just a declared two-way prop, consistent with
the two-way widget props in ARCHITECTURE.md. A caller tunes its timing the
same way as any bound prop:
SlInput(value = wire(my_reactive, wire_debounce(200))).


3. Ceremony levels

Three ways to reach non-trivial JS, by need:

Need Use
One-off non-standard event on a standard element tags$div(`on:foo-bar` = handler)
Web Component — events + properties + autobind, no JS lifecycle custom_tag()
Reactive props with init / update / destroy lifecycle IridWidget (ARCHITECTURE.md)

custom_tag() sits between the one-off escape and the full widget: it
bakes an element's vocabulary into a reusable constructor but owns no JS
lifecycle — the element's own implementation does that. When a component
needs irid-managed init/update/destroy, it's an IridWidget instead.


4. Open items

  • Per-instance property marking (§2) — irid_prop() wrapper vs. some
    other non-dot mechanism, now that dot-prefix props are gone.
  • bind with a mismatched property namebind = c(value = "onInput") assumes the new value is read from the element's value
    property on that event. An element exposing it under a different
    property needs a richer declaration (e.g. bind = list(value = list(on = "onInput", prop = "currentValue"))). Defer until a real case.
  • Validation — like the two-way widget-prop rework, vet against a real
    Web Component (e.g. a Shoelace input) before locking.
